What is it like to work in Jackson, MS?

Working in Jackson, MS, offers a mix of professional opportunities and a welcoming community. The city is home to major companies like Entergy Mississippi and Trustmark Corporation, providing stable job prospects. Jackson also boasts attractions like the Mississippi Museum of Natural Science and the Old Capitol Museum, making it a pleasant place to live and work.


The job market in Jackson features a variety of industries, including healthcare, education, and finance. Notable employers include St. Dominic's Hospital and the Mississippi Department of Education. The city's central location makes it easy to explore nearby attractions, such as the Mississippi River and the Natchez Trace Parkway.

Do you need a car in Jackson, MS?

Having a car in Jackson, MS, can make your job search easier. Many employers prefer candidates who can drive to work, especially in areas with less public transportation.


Jackson's public transit system is limited, so a car helps you reach more job opportunities. It also gives you the flexibility to adjust your schedule and travel to different parts of the city.

Jackson, MS, offers several transportation options for those who do not own a car. Many residents rely on public transportation, such as the Jackson Transit Authority buses. These buses cover a wide range of routes throughout the city, making it easier to get to work or other destinations. Additionally, ride-sharing services like Uber and Lyft are popular choices for those needing a quick and convenient way to travel.

The weather in Jackson can also influence transportation choices. Summers are hot and humid, which can make walking or biking less appealing. However, the city has many bike lanes and walking paths, making it possible to enjoy these modes of transportation during cooler months. For those who prefer not to drive, carpooling with colleagues or friends can be a practical solution, especially during peak traffic hours.

Overall, while owning a car can be helpful, it is not a necessity in Jackson. The city's public transportation, ride-sharing services, and alternative commuting options provide ample choices for those without a vehicle. Considering the weather and traffic patterns, job seekers can find a suitable way to get around the city.

What are the best neighborhoods in Jackson, MS?

Jackson, MS, offers a variety of neighborhoods that cater to different lifestyles and preferences. For job seekers, choosing the right neighborhood can significantly impact daily commutes and overall quality of life. Here are some of the best neighborhoods in Jackson to consider for a comfortable and convenient living experience.

First, the Fondren area is known for its vibrant community and easy access to downtown Jackson. This neighborhood features a mix of residential and commercial spaces, making it ideal for those who enjoy a lively atmosphere. Next, Ridgeland provides a suburban feel with excellent schools and a strong sense of community. It is a great choice for families looking for a safe and welcoming environment. Another desirable neighborhood is North Jackson, which offers a blend of historic charm and modern amenities. It is close to major highways, making it convenient for commuters. The Germantown area is another excellent option, known for its upscale homes and proximity to shopping and dining options. Lastly, the South Jackson neighborhood is perfect for those seeking a quieter, more residential setting with plenty of green spaces and community events.
